I believe Krolik could be either. There are quite a few Polish surnames which can be.
Keep in mind also that so-called assimilated or converted Polish-Jews often changed an obviously Jewish surname to one that would not be recognisably Jewish as they wanted to be totally integrated within Polish life. This was mainly Polish-Jews from the professional classes.
